I'm attempting to do bandwidth synthesis imaging of wideband continuum data and 
finding IMAGR to be fussy. I have limited experience in this area, so I don't know to what
extent this is expected, or a function of my having things poorly optimized.

Today's problem (which I've encountered before) is that after
a few CLEAN cycles, IMAGR abruptly aborts, e.g., 

IMAGR1 18:18:57 PBFCCT correcting CC for primary beam   Field    1 ch  511-  511
IMAGR1 18:18:57 PBFCCT correcting CC for primary beam   Field    1 ch  512-  512
IMAGR1 18:18:57 ZABORS: signal 11 received
IMAGR1 18:18:57 ABORT!

I'm guessing it's running out of memory? In today's case, I had 32 IFs X 16 spectral channels X 2 Stokes
and was trying to make a 1024 image.  However, a small change in GAIN from 0.1 to 0.15
allowed it to run to completion. (Is the reason for this obvious?)

If I instead average down to 8 spectral channels but keep GAIN=0.1, it still dies at a similar point, but 
now with a much more explicit explanation:
